Abstract
We address the problem of having rigid values for attributes in the critical data set like heart disease data set. Here we propose the process of fuzzifying the crisp values by changing the appropriate intervals into linguistic variables. In this paper, we demonstrate the effect of such a process the mining tool WEKA. We obtain the error rate and accuracy by building the familiar learning model.
